I own a 570S and have driven but do not own a GT3.2 manual and a GT3.2RS, not much experience with the dot 1 but I would guess they are pretty similar. I would rate the McLaren's steering (hydraulic rather than electric) higher, and prefer the chassis dynamics as well. If anyone has Lotus experience, you'll know what I mean when I say the 570S feels like an Exige on mega-roids. Mac has significantly more thrust, and if you keep it in the happy part of the rev band, basically zero turbo lag. As a weekend canyon runner, I would prefer the 570S, as a track car the GT Porsches win hands down. They sound better, too, but frankly I have never understood the willingness to give up performance for sound, but I recognize I'm in the minority on that question. To me, the 570S with sport exhaust sounds just fine, but yeah, not as loud/cool as the muffler-delete GT3s out there. Maybe Ducati will chime in here, he owned a 570S and now has a dot 2 RS.

Against a .1 gt3, there is no question in my mind I'd be going to the Mclaren, but mainly because the Mclaren is more fun playing with boost and hooning around on roads, where the Gt3 is really only fun at high rpm (which is great in theory, but for a road car gets pretty old, pretty quick. The presence of the Macca is also really cool, and something that doesn't tend to wear out after you've gotten used to the driving dynamics. Yes, the 570 is a little quirky, but you get the hang of it pretty quick, and its a complete blast. Also, its a canyon WEAPON with the suspension setup the way it is...it can handle bad tarmac really well to boot.
